VB(Visual Basic)是一种由微软公司开发的编程语言,广泛应用于Windows应用程序的开发。MySQL是一种流行的关系型数据库管理系统,用于存储和管理数据。
将VB中的数据导入MySQL数据库通常涉及以下几个步骤:
数据导入的方式可以分为:
以下是一个简单的VB代码示例,演示如何将数据导入MySQL数据库:
Imports System.Data.SqlClient
Imports MySql.Data.MySqlClient
Module Module1
Sub Main()
Dim connectionString As String = "Server=localhost;Database=mydatabase;Uid=myuser;Pwd=mypassword;"
Dim connection As New MySqlConnection(connectionString)
Try
connection.Open()
' 创建数据表
Dim createTableQuery As String = "CREATE TABLE IF NOT EXISTS users (id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(255), age INT)"
Dim createTableCommand As New MySqlCommand(createTableQuery, connection)
createTableCommand.ExecuteNonQuery()
' 插入数据
Dim insertQuery As String = "INSERT INTO users (name, age) VALUES (@name, @age)"
Dim insertCommand As New MySqlCommand(insertQuery, connection)
Dim parameters As New MySqlParameter()
parameters.ParameterName = "@name"
parameters.Value = "John Doe"
insertCommand.Parameters.Add(parameters)
parameters = New MySqlParameter()
parameters.ParameterName = "@age"
parameters.Value = 30
insertCommand.Parameters.Add(parameters)
insertCommand.ExecuteNonQuery()
Console.WriteLine("Data inserted successfully!")
Catch ex As Exception
Console.WriteLine("Error: " & ex.Message)
Finally
connection.Close()
End Try
End Sub
End Module
通过以上步骤和示例代码,你应该能够成功地将VB中的数据导入到MySQL数据库中。如果遇到具体问题,请提供详细的错误信息,以便进一步诊断和解决。
领取专属 10元无门槛券
手把手带您无忧上云